The History of Baseball in Maine

The history of baseball in Maine dates back to the 19th century. The first recorded baseball game took place in 1858 in the town of Portland. As the sport grew in popularity, various amateur leagues were formed, leading to the establishment of more organized baseball in the state.

Early Beginnings

By the early 1900s, Maine had established several semi-professional teams that competed against each other and other teams from New England. The sport continued to evolve, with the introduction of minor league baseball and an increasing number of players from Maine making their mark on the national stage.

Professional Baseball Teams in Maine

While Maine does not have a Major League Baseball team, it is home to the Portland Sea Dogs, which serve as the Double-A affiliate for the Boston Red Sox. This connection provides Maine fans with the opportunity to watch future MLB stars develop their skills right in their own backyard.

Portland Sea Dogs

Founded in 1994, the Sea Dogs have become a beloved team in the state. Their games draw large crowds, and they play a vital role in the local community, often engaging in charitable activities and community outreach programs.
